The station boasts comprehensive facilities to cater to every traveler’s needs. The ticket office operates from 5:45 AM to 8:00 PM Monday through Saturday and 7:45 AM to 8:00 PM on Sundays. For those who book tickets online, collection is a breeze with easily accessible ticket machines, and there's dedicated support for smartcard users as well.
Accessibility is a priority with step-free access throughout the station, alongside accessible ticket machines and well-equipped waiting areas. Although there's no luggage storage, heated waiting rooms are available on several platforms. Edenbridge Town Station is equipped to meet the essential needs of its passengers, ensuring a seamless travel experience. The ticket office operates weekdays and Saturdays, with early morning to early afternoon hours, but closes on Sundays. For those opting for self-service, ticket machines are available for purchasing and collecting tickets bought online. Importantly, the station incorporates accessible ticket machines that accommodate Disabled Persons Railcard discounts.
Customer support at the station is readily available through help points and staff assistance during peak hours on weekdays and Saturdays. Security is a priority, evidenced by the station's CCTV installations. Although facilities such as shops and refreshment stands are absent, pay phones are available for public use. On the downside, the lack of accessible toilets and waiting rooms may limit comfort for some travelers.
When it comes to onward travel, Edenbridge Town Station offers several options. A taxi rank is conveniently located just outside, perfect for those who prefer personal transport. For more economical travel, bus services are accessible, providing an excellent link to surrounding areas. Although the station does not offer cycling hire facilities, cyclists can utilize the 10-cycle storage stands available near the station, albeit at the owner's risk.
